Portugal U21 1-1 England U21
Theo Walcott
Walcott went close to winning the match for England Under-21s
England Under-21s moved a step closer to next year's play-offs for the 2009 European Championship by coming from behind to draw away in Portugal.

Stuart Pearce's injury-hit side went behind when Craig Gardner fouled Adelino Vieirinha, the winger picking himself up to score from the spot.

Theo Walcott fired wide before Adam Johnson restored parity, volleying home from Joe Mattock's long throw.

Walcott forced a fine save from Ricardo Batista as England finished stronger.

The draw leaves England six points clear of Portugal at the top of Group Three, with Pearce's side having two games remaining and Portugal three.


Portugal U21: Ricardo Batista, Nuno Andre, Antunes, Paulo Machado, Vieirinha (Bruno Pereirinha 77), Pele (Celestino 66), Joao Moreira (Targino 46), Joao Moutinho, Vasco Fernandes, Goncalo Brandao, Carlos Saleiro.
Subs Not Used: Rui Patricio, Bruno Pinheiro, Helder Barbosa.

Goals: Vieirinha 3 pen.

England U21: Hart, Gardner, Steven Taylor (Mancienne 46), Wheater, Mattock, Cattermole, Huddlestone, Muamba, Milner, Walcott, Johnson.
Subs Not Used: Heaton, Connolly, Leadbitter, Surman, Stearman, Miller.

Booked: Steven Taylor, Muamba, Walcott.

Goals: Johnson 49.

Att: 5,468.

Ref: Istvan Vad (Hungary).
